The Code of Conduct Bureau (CCB) has said it cannot make public the details of President Buhari’s assets declaration form submitted before the February 23rd presidential election. The Bureau made this known in response to a request by the Socio-Economic Rights and Accountability Project (SERAP) for the disclosure of assets declaration submitted by successive presidents and governors from 1999 till date.
